Dual Monitors 2009-2010

All DECS public computer labs now have dual monitors. Dual monitors serve two main functions: they offer more screen space for students to spread out their work and multi-task more efficiently, and the most beneficial purpose is the improvement in classroom instruction. Each dual monitor lab has an "Instructors Station." This station can send the contents of its primary monitor to the students' secondary monitor. Instead of projecting the instructors' primary monitor onto the wall with a projector, each student computer can have the instructors' monitor displayed on one of their monitors. This way every student has a clear view of the instructors' lecture presentation.

DECS Public Computer Labs with Dual Monitors: 1307, 1312, 1318, 1320, 1328, 2200, 2314
